

I Am My Films: A Portrait of Werner Herzog(1979)
I Am My Films: A Portrait of Werner Herzog is a documentary that captures the visionary German director reflecting on his groundbreaking work through the late 1970s. The film presents Herzog in conversation, tracing his creative evolution across his most influential early projects. Rather than a conventional biography, it functions as an intimate portrait of an artist grappling with his own legacy and artistic philosophy. Herzog's distinctive voice and uncompromising vision emerge through his recollections, offering insight into the obsessions and unconventional methods that defined his filmmaking. The documentary serves as both a record of his formative period and a meditation on cinema itself, revealing how personal conviction and relentless ambition shaped some of the era's most provocative and unforgettable films.
